Volcanic ash drifting from Indonesia’s Mount Anak Krakatau has disrupted air travel across Asia, with 2,927 flight delays and 584 cancellations recorded at major hubs including Delhi and Mumbai.
Delhi’s Indira Gandhi International Airport recorded 177 delays and 4 cancellations, while Mumbai’s Chhatrapati Shivaji Maharaj International Airport reported 245 delays and 3 cancellations.
Among Indian carriers, IndiGo logged 258 delayed flights and 9 cancellations, while Air India recorded 114 delays and 2 cancellations, according to tracking data reported on Tuesday.
Tokyo’s Haneda Airport was the hardest hit by volume, with 394 delayed flights, while Jakarta’s Soekarno-Hatta International Airport recorded the most cancellations at 207.
The disruption stems from an ongoing eruption at Mount Anak Krakatau that began on September 4, which has kept the volcano at Alert Level III with airports reopening in phases.
Mount Anak Krakatau, in Indonesia’s Sunda Strait, began erupting on September 4, triggering a five-day aviation shutdown that closed eight Indonesian airports and stranded more than 270,000 passengers.
Jakarta’s Soekarno-Hatta International Airport recorded the highest number of cancellations in the region, with 207 flights called off as ash plumes drifted over the airspace.
Tokyo’s Haneda Airport recorded the highest delay count of any single airport, with 394 delayed flights as congestion rippled across connecting hubs.
Shanghai Pudong International Airport also reported disruption, logging 178 delays and 8 cancellations as the ash cloud affected regional air corridors.
As of September 7, Indonesian volcanological authorities kept Anak Krakatau at Alert Level III, warning that the risk of further eruptions remained high and that airports were reopening in phases rather than all at once.
Etihad Airways and SpiceJet were among the international and domestic carriers reporting delays on services to and from Delhi and Mumbai during the disruption.
Volcanic ash poses a direct safety hazard to jet engines, which is why aviation authorities impose ground restrictions and altitude diversions rather than allowing aircraft to fly through affected airspace.
